Maintaining Good Brain Health: A Tele-town Hall

Posted on 08/06/20 by Jamie Harding

Please join AARP Alabama for a telephone townhall on Friday, August 7, from 11:30 a.m. – 12:30 p.m. Learn more about protecting your brain health, what’s normal with aging and what’s not, and whether the stress we’re feeling during this pandemic might affect our health and brain health.

OUR EXPERT PANEL: 

Dr. Ronald Lazar, Director of UAB’s Evelyn F. McKnight Brain Institute. Through laboratory, clinical and translational research, the Brain Institute expands knowledge and explores new treatments and cures.

Dr. Joshua Klapow, clinical psychologist and adjunct professor of Public Health at UAB. He’s also a certified disaster mental health specialist.

Sarah Lenz Lock, executive director of the Global Council on Brain Health, an independent  collaborative of scientists, doctors and policy experts convened by AARP to provide trusted information on brain health.
